Anytype Features 2026
Local-First Storage
All data is stored on your device first before syncing, ensuring you always have access to your information offline and maintaining full control over your data.
Zero-Knowledge Encryption
Data is encrypted on your device before syncing, using a 12-word recovery phrase similar to Bitcoin wallets. Anytype cannot access or decrypt your data.
Peer-to-Peer Sync
Sync data across verified devices in your local network using p2p technology, with optional remote backup nodes for cross-network synchronization.
Self-Hosting Option
Run your own backup node to maintain complete control over data storage and sync infrastructure, with no membership fees required for self-hosted networks.

Anytype Pricing 2026
View SourceThe free tier with 100MB storage and unlimited local-only usage is genuinely functional for individual users who don't need cross-device sync. Most people who stick with Anytype end up on Plus at $4 monthly for 1GB and unlimited shared channels, which covers typical personal knowledge management needs. Pro at $8 monthly adds 10GB and shorter ANY ID usernames, worth considering only if you're syncing media-heavy databases or want web publishing with a custom handle. Annual billing cuts 20% across all tiers.

What It's Like Day-to-Day
The interface feels immediately familiar if you've used Notion, but the underlying model is fundamentally different. Instead of pages in folders, you work with objects that can be anything: a task, a person, a book, a meeting. You define the types and relations, then watch your workspace adapt to how you actually think. One Reddit reviewer captured it well, noting the graph view and object relations make it feel like "a second brain that actually grows with you." The flexibility is the point, but it's also why the first few hours feel disorienting.

How secure is my data with Anytype?
Anytype uses zero-knowledge encryption with a 12-word recovery phrase generated on-device (similar to Bitcoin wallets). All data is stored locally first and encrypted before syncing to other devices or backup nodes. Anytype cannot access or decrypt your data. You can self-host your own backup node or use local-only mode for maximum privacy.
